Dean Knox is a scholar working on Sociology and Political Science, Political Science and International Relations and Statistics and Probability. According to data from OpenAlex, Dean Knox has authored 19 papers receiving a total of 724 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 13 papers in Sociology and Political Science, 11 papers in Political Science and International Relations and 5 papers in Statistics and Probability. Recurrent topics in Dean Knox's work include Electoral Systems and Political Participation (5 papers), Policing Practices and Perceptions (5 papers) and Advanced Causal Inference Techniques (5 papers). Dean Knox is often cited by papers focused on Electoral Systems and Political Participation (5 papers), Policing Practices and Perceptions (5 papers) and Advanced Causal Inference Techniques (5 papers). Dean Knox collaborates with scholars based in United States, Germany and Bulgaria. Dean Knox's co-authors include Jonathan Mummolo, Will Lowe, Bocar Ba, Roman Rivera, Christopher Lucas, Jan Simson, Manvir Singh, Erin J. Hopkins, Max M. Krasnow and Steven Pinker and has published in prestigious journals such as Science,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ences and Journal of the American Statistical Association.
